What Types of Oregon Trimmer Line Are Available and How Do They Differ?

There are several types of Oregon trimmer line available, each designed for specific cutting tasks and conditions.

  • Round Line: This is the most common type of trimmer line, designed for general-purpose trimming and edging.
  • Square Line: Square trimmer lines have sharp edges that provide a cleaner cut, making them ideal for tougher weeds and thicker grass.
  • Star-Shaped Line: Featuring multiple points, star-shaped lines offer enhanced cutting power and are effective against dense vegetation.
  • Twisted Line: This line is twisted for added strength and reduced drag, making it suitable for high-performance tasks where durability is essential.
  • Multi-Edge Line: With multiple cutting edges, this line is designed for efficient cutting and is perfect for heavy-duty use in commercial settings.

The round line is versatile and works well for routine yard maintenance, providing a smooth cut without excessive wear on the trimmer. Its simplicity makes it a favorite among homeowners.

Square line is advantageous for those dealing with tougher weeds or thicker grass, as its sharp edges can slice through vegetation more effectively, resulting in a cleaner cut compared to round line.

Star-shaped line excels in dense growth, utilizing its multiple points for aggressive cutting, making it a preferred choice for landscapers who need to tackle challenging areas.

Twisted line is engineered for reduced friction and increased durability, ideal for high-speed trimmers, which require a robust line to withstand the rigors of heavy use without breaking easily.

Multi-edge line combines the benefits of various cutting angles, ensuring high efficiency and longevity, making it a top choice for professionals who demand performance in their trimming tasks.

How Does Line Thickness Impact Trimming Efficiency?

The thickness of trimmer line plays a significant role in trimming efficiency, affecting both the performance and application of the line.

  • Thin Line: Thin trimmer lines, typically ranging from 0.065 to 0.085 inches, are ideal for light-duty tasks like trimming grass around flower beds or along sidewalks. They provide a clean cut and are easier to maneuver, but may wear out quickly against tougher weeds or thicker vegetation.
  • Medium Line: Medium thickness lines, generally between 0.085 to 0.105 inches, strike a balance between durability and cutting efficiency. These lines can handle moderate vegetation and are versatile for different trimming tasks, making them a popular choice for homeowners who want a reliable option without excess weight.
  • Thick Line: Thick trimmer lines, usually over 0.105 inches, are designed for heavy-duty applications, making them suitable for tackling dense weeds, thick grass, and overgrown areas. They are more durable and can withstand rigorous use, but may require more power from the trimmer, which can be a drawback for some users.
  • Specialty Lines: Specialty trimmer lines include those with unique shapes, such as square or twisted profiles, which can enhance cutting efficiency by providing sharper edges. These lines are often used in professional settings where optimal performance is required, as they can create cleaner cuts and reduce the amount of time spent on trimming tasks.

What Role Does Material Composition Play in Performance?

The material composition of a trimmer line significantly influences its performance, durability, and suitability for various tasks.

  • Nylon: Nylon is the most common material used for trimmer lines due to its flexibility and strength. It can withstand high levels of stress without breaking, making it ideal for cutting through thick grass and weeds effectively.
  • Composite Materials: Composite lines often combine nylon with other materials, such as additives that enhance durability and reduce wear. This type of trimmer line can provide improved cutting performance and longevity, making it suitable for heavy-duty tasks.
  • Metal-Core: Metal-core trimmer lines feature a core made of metal, which adds to their strength and cutting efficiency. These lines are particularly effective for tackling tougher vegetation and are less likely to snap under pressure, but they may cause more wear on the trimmer head.
  • Square and Star-Shaped Lines: The shape of the trimmer line can affect cutting efficiency; square and star-shaped lines offer sharper edges for better cutting performance. These shapes can slice through grass and weeds more effectively than rounded lines, making them a popular choice for professional landscapers.
  • Diameter: The diameter of the trimmer line also plays a crucial role in its performance. Thicker lines are more robust and can handle tougher jobs, while thinner lines are better suited for lighter tasks and more precise cutting.

How Can Proper Maintenance of Oregon Trimmer Line Enhance Its Longevity?

Proper maintenance of Oregon trimmer line can significantly enhance its longevity and performance.

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ping the trimmer line free from debris and grass buildup can prevent clogging and ensure smooth operation.
  • Correct Storage: Storing the trimmer line in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ight helps maintain its elasticity and prevents it from becoming brittle.
  • Correct Line Installation: Properly installing the trimmer line according to the manufacturer’s guidelines reduces wear and tear, ensuring optimal cutting performance.
  • Using the Right Line Diameter: Selecting the appropriate diameter for the specific trimmer model allows for efficient cutting and minimizes the risk of line breakage.
  • Checking for Damage: Regularly inspecting the trimmer line for nicks, abrasions, or fraying allows for timely replacements, which helps maintain cutting efficiency.

Regular cleaning of the trimmer line is essential as it removes any grass, dirt, or debris that can cause blockages and hinder performance. This practice not only improves the efficiency of the trimmer but also prevents unnecessary wear on the line itself.

Correct storage plays a crucial role in preserving the integrity of the trimmer line. By keeping it in a cool, dry area, you prevent exposure to moisture and heat, which can degrade the material and lead to premature failure.

Correct line installation is vital for the longevity of the trimmer line. Following the manufacturer’s instructions ensures that the line is securely fed through the trimmer head, reducing the chances of jamming or excessive wear during operation.

Using the right line diameter for your trimmer is important as it affects the cutting power and efficiency. A line that is too thin may break easily, while one that is too thick can strain the motor, leading to potential damage and reduced performance.

Checking for damage on the trimmer line should be a routine part of maintenance. Identifying any signs of wear, such as fraying or nicks, allows for timely replacement and helps maintain the effectiveness of the trimmer, ensuring a clean cut every time.
